    Just for the record, WoW is not the only 3rd-person non-fixed perspective game (nor the first), crafting has nothing in common, WoW does not use a Limited Action Set / Deck system, WoW doesn't have housing, WoW doesn't have personal NPC vendors, you NEVER have to read the quests in WoW, etc, etc

    I agree SotA looks more true-medieval, but WoW is completely stylized.
